Current Industrial Landscape

The Combined Charging System Type 1 (CCS1) remains the dominant standard for DC fast charging in North America and South Korea. As the global EV adoption rate accelerates, the demand for Level 3 DC infrastructure has shifted from 50kW basic units to 150kW-360kW ultra-fast systems. Manufacturers are now focusing on modularity and high-uptime reliability to meet the needs of highway corridors and urban hubs.

The Shift to Liquid Cooling

With battery capacities increasing, the industry is moving toward higher current outputs. Our factory specializes in both air-cooled and liquid-cooled charging guns, allowing for continuous 400A+ delivery without thermal throttling. This is critical for heavy-duty commercial transport and high-traffic public stations.

The Future of CCS1 Technology

V2G and Bi-Directional Charging

The next frontier is Vehicle-to-Grid (V2G). Our latest CCS1 prototypes are exploring bi-directional energy transfer, allowing EVs to act as mobile batteries for grid stabilization during peak hours. For wholesale buyers, investing in V2G-ready hardware is a future-proofing strategy.

Procurement Checklist for Enterprises

  • Input Voltage Compatibility: Ensure the factory can customize for 480V 3-phase (US) or other regional requirements.
  • Scalability: Can the charger be upgraded from 120kW to 180kW by adding modules?
  • Maintenance Support: Look for manufacturers providing remote diagnostics through OCPP.
  • Certification: Ensure compliance with UL 2202, CE, or local energy board standards.

What is the difference between CCS1 and CCS2?
CCS1 (Combined Charging System Type 1) is primarily used in North America and South Korea, utilizing a J1772 connector base for AC. CCS2 is the European standard based on the Mennekes (Type 2) connector. We manufacture both standards to cater to global markets.
